Warning Signs You Need Slab Leak Water Removal
Ignoring the warning signs of a slab leak can lead to costly repairs and even health hazards. Here are some common signs to look out for: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Unpleasant odors in your home can be a sign of a slab leak. If you notice a persistent musty smell, it’s time to call our team.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age beneath the surface. Don’t ignore this warning sign, it can lead to costly repairs down the line.
Visible Water Stains or Puddles
Visible water stains or puddles on your floor or walls can be a sign of a slab leak. Don’t wait, call our team to assess the situation.
Increased Water Bills
If your water bills are suddenly increasing without explanation, it could be a sign of a slab leak. Our team can help you diagnose the issue and provide a solution.
Cracks in the Slab or Foundation
Cracks in the slab or foundation can be a sign of a slab leak. If you notice any cracks, don’t hesitate to contact our team for help.
Water Damage to Surrounding Areas
Water damage to surrounding areas, such as walls or ceilings, can be a sign of a slab leak. Our team can help you mitigate the damage and prevent further issues.

Slab Leak Water Removal Cost in Altadena, CA
The cost of Slab Leak Water Removal in Altadena, CA, can vary depending on the severity of the leak,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area and severity of leak |
| Slab Repair or Replacement | $1,000 – $10,000 | Size of slab, material, and complexity of repair |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area and severity of moisture buildup |
| Final Inspection and Cleanup |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area and complexity of cleanup |
